Cedar Crest Golf Club in Murfreesboro sprawls across rolling farmland accented with groves of mature trees. The fairways on the front nine are wide open but they become narrower and tree lined on the back nine. The greens play fast and true and they are also well conditioned. There are not many sand traps to contend with but a smattering of elevation changes throughout the golf course cause an occasional uneven lie. Seasoned golfers looking for a challenge won't find it here but what you will find is a relaxed atmosphere that is ideal for a quick, casual round that is player friendly enough for beginners. In addition to the course, Cedar Chest Golf Club offers extensive practice facilities including a driving range and a two-tiered practice green.

There are good things about this course but they do not out weigh the average and below average items for me. The greens were in terrific shape, but like most public courses people are too lazy to fix their ball marks. The fairways were average, several holes had bare spots in the fairway. The range only has mats for warming up and only has 5 positions to hit from. The most unpleasant issue of the day was slow play! Since we played as a twosome we expect some waiting, but we waited up to 10 minutes to hit on multiple holes, we drove up to tee boxes before the group in front of us teed off multiple times and with an open hole in front of them they would not let us play through, a marshall would be nice!

Nice greens, fairway problems

My friend and I have forever labeled this course as "Lumpy Crest". Fairway conditions were terrible on the front 9, not as bad on the back. Our cart's suspension definitely got a workout.
There is an overabundance of trees and wooded areas to lose strokes. At least 2 of the holes have tree lines that intersect the fairway with very little room for error. The greens were in much better condition than the fairways.
Small driving range, mats only. The balls were obviously only those which were lost during rounds; some were busted, others were muddy, others were laden with dried grass.
